A graph is of parabolic or hyperbolic type if the simple random walk on the vertices is, respectively, recurrent or transient. A plane triangulation graph is CP-parabolic or CP-hyperbolic if the maximal circle packing determined by the graph packs, respectively, the complex plane C or the Poincar e disk D. Let M be a closed hyperbolic three manifold. We show that the number of genus g surface subgroups of π1(M ) grows like g.
